Vasya, or Mr. Vasily Petrov is a dean of a department in a local university. After the winter exams he got his hands on a group's gradebook. Overall the group has $ n $ students. They received marks for $ m $ subjects. Each student got a mark from $ 1 $ to $ 9 $ (inclusive) for each subject. Let's consider a student the best at some subject, if there is no student who got a higher mark for this subject. Let's consider a student successful, if there exists a subject he is the best at. Your task is to find the number of successful students in the group.

The first input line contains two integers $ n $ and $ m $ ( $ 1<=n,m<=100 $ ) — the number of students and the number of subjects, correspondingly. Next $ n $ lines each containing $ m $ characters describe the gradebook. Each character in the gradebook is a number from $ 1 $ to $ 9 $ . Note that the marks in a rows are not sepatated by spaces.

输出格式


Print the single number — the number of successful students in the given group.
